The adtech product team is seeking an experienced Senior Product Manager to spearhead the development and management of our targeting and audience products. Our team is growing and tasked with building a competitive audience solution tech stack, supported by our rich first party data environment.

This role will focus on delivering best-in-class solutions that enable advertisers to accurately target and reach their desired audiences across multiple channels. The ideal candidate will have a deep understanding of targeting and audience segmentation, ML modeled audiences, and the digital advertising ecosystem.

At Walmart, we offer competitive pay as well as performance-based bonus awards and other great benefits for a happier mind, body, and wallet. Health benefits include medical, vision and dental coverage. Financial benefits include 401(k), stock purchase and company-paid life insurance. Paid time off benefits include PTO (including sick leave), parental leave, family care leave, bereavement, jury duty, and voting. Other benefits include short-term and long-term disability, company discounts, Military Leave Pay, adoption and surrogacy expense reimbursement, and more.

Live Better U is a Walmart-paid education benefit program for full-time and part-time associates in Walmart and Sam's Club facilities. Programs range from high school completion to bachelor's degrees, including English Language Learning and short-form certificates. Tuition, books, and fees are completely paid for by Walmart.
